SB50   by Senator Mike Reese      

GAMBLING:  Prohibits certain persons from wagering on sports events. (gov sig) (EN SEE FISC NOTE LF EX)

Current Status:  Signed by the Governor - Act 284

05/28S  Effective date 5/28/2024.
05/28S  Signed by the Governor. Becomes Act No. 284.
05/28S82  Sent to the Governor by the Secretary of the Senate on 5/23/2024.
05/23H1  Signed by the Speaker of the House.
05/23S101  Enrolled. Signed by the President of the Senate.
05/22S16  Rules suspended. Amendments proposed by the House read and concurred in by a vote of 36 yeas and 0 nays.
05/21S35  Received from the House with amendments.
05/21H42  Read third time by title, roll called on final passage, yeas 90, nays 3. Finally passed, ordered to the Senate.
05/20H  Scheduled for floor debate on 05/21/2024.
05/13H11  Read by title, amended, passed to 3rd reading.
05/09H2  Reported without Legislative Bureau amendments.
05/08H43  Reported with amendments (7-0). Referred to the Legislative Bureau.
03/20H6  Read by title, under the rules, referred to the Committee on Administration of Criminal Justice.
03/19H2  Received in the House from the Senate, read by title, lies over under the rules.
03/18S15  Read by title, passed by a vote of 37 yeas and 0 nays, and sent to the House. Motion to reconsider tabled.
03/13S7  Read by title. Committee amendments read and adopted. Ordered engrossed and passed to third reading and final passage.
03/12S4  Reported with amendments.
03/11S6  Introduced in the Senate; read by title. Rules suspended. Read second time and referred to the Committee on Judiciary B.
02/26S  Prefiled and under the rules provisionally referred to the Committee on Judiciary B.
